Ed McCaffrey, Broncos legend, hilariously reacts to son signing with Raiders

Ed McCaffrey is probably best known for the nine seasons he spent playing for the Denver Broncos, so it’s no wonder that he took to Twitter and said the following when his son, former Duke Blue Devils receiver Max McCaffrey, signed with the Oakland Raiders as an undrafted free agent.

All joking aside, however, McCaffrey was genuinely proud of his son and also tweeted this first.

Max McCaffrey left Duke with 117 career receptions for 1,341 yards and 12 touchdowns, and should have a shot at cracking Oakland’s roster, maybe as the No. 3 or No. 4 receiver behind starters Michael Crabtree and Amari Cooper. That’d be a great accomplishment on his end, but also one that means his dad would probably have to switch allegiances once and for all. I mean, family comes first, right?
